Glambassador
"Glambassador" in a Sentence (4 examples)
Glambassador … Maria Sharapova off court. (photo caption)
Ellie Anne's Aphrodite among aristocrats, a glambassador! She, Congress's darling, slipped from one man's arms to the next like she was doing the Samba with less sex appeal.
Dita Von Teese: I like to call myself a "glambassador." I believe in glamour and sensuality and using these tools in everyday life, not just to put on a show for men.
